The Cabinet Office carries out a detailed evaluation of the Fast Stream recruitment process, in line with the Civil Service Commissioners' Recruitment Code. This not only includes analysis of assessment data from each assessment stage, but also an analysis of stakeholder feedback and evaluation against Cabinet Office's strategic initiatives.
In assessment centres, assessors record evidence on each of the competencies being tested. This evidence then forms the basis of a comprehensive report consisting of a score for each competency, an overall score and detailed comments about the candidate's performance in each competency. The report takes the same form, and is equally detailed, for successful and unsuccessful candidates. All reports are checked for consistency and clarity by a Quality Assurance Coordinator. In addition, quality checks are carried out by expert assessors.
